I started out by offering free shoots to family and friends so as to get some experience. I found it better not to cast the freebie net too wide otherwise everyone will assume you'll do it for free. But it doesn't take long to get a few willing guinea pigs and family will often be more patient while you try things out. I've since been booked to come back for a paid shoot by a couple of family members so it did work for me :)
